CDT Releases Report on ICANN and Internet Governance

In the context of ongoing global debates about Internet governance, CDT has
released a report calling for continued reform at the Internet Corporation
on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N). The report calls on ICANN to focus on
its limited mission and bottom-up, consensus-based approach, which remains
the best model for managing core Internet naming and numbering functions.
ICANN is meeting July 19-23 in Kuala Lumpur. July 14, 2004
